What is taking up so much space on my phone?

On an Android Phone, Go to Settings > Storage
There, you'll see exactly how much space you're using and how much is being devoted to categories such as apps, images, and videos. Tapping on one of those categories provides more detail, such as which apps are using the most space.

What apps are taking up my storage?

Check the storage space of the apps
  • On your Android device, open Files by Google .
  • At the bottom, tap Browse .
  • Scroll to Apps under "Categories."
  • Tap Calculate storage. ...
  • On the confirmation dialog, tap Continue.
  • On the “Usage access” screen, tap Files by Google.
  • Turn “Permit usage access” on.

How do I stop my storage from filling up?

How to clear cache on Android:
  1. Open Settings.
  2. Choose Apps (or Apps & notifications).
  3. Tap an often used app, like Chrome. Tap Storage (or Storage & cache).
  4. Tap Clear cache.
  5. Repeat these steps for other heavily used apps on your device.

Why is my storage still full after deleting photos?

A common reason for this issue revolves around the Recently Deleted album in the Photos app. This album allows you to recover deleted photos and videos for up to 30 days after deleting them. Like the Recycle Bin on your computer, it acts as a temporary safety net in case you change your mind.

What is other in my storage and why is it taking up so much space?

The “Other” storage category contains data from apps you have installed on your smartphone or tablet. It includes items such as system files, cached data, and temporary files that do not fall into any other storage categories.
